Since launch we've made some modest changes to encourage co-op play but there's still room to go farther. The degree of co-op efficiency depends heavily on the co-ordination of the party, skill builds, and the relative gear level of the teammates. Co-op is already more efficient for some players, but this is the exception rather than the norm. "Co-op play in general is a big focus of the 1.0.8 patch and efficiency is definitely one component of that. "We are looking to improve co-op farming efficiency in 1.0.8," he wrote. Details regarding how this will exactly work are still slim however, Cheng states the team did not want to "make multiplayer feel 'mandatory' for thos who prefer to play solo."
